How the Mazda 6 gen 1 2003–2008 Transmission Actually Fails

Overview

The 2003–2008 Mazda 6. I’ve worked on these since they were new. Back when they still smelled like plastic and optimism.

From a drivetrain standpoint, this platform is simple. Transverse engine. Integrated transaxle. No CVT nonsense. No dual-clutch experiments. Just old-school hydraulic automatics and cable-shift manuals that either work… or don’t.

There were no transmission recalls that screamed “design defect.” No mass grenade events. What we got instead were service bulletins — Mazda reminding techs to use the correct ATF (M-V) and to stop reusing certain oil pan bolts because they stretched. That’s not scandal. That’s maintenance discipline.

In my experience, these trannies don’t fail because they’re weak. They fail because people ignore fluid. They trust the “lifetime” idea. They assume no dipstick means no service. That’s where the mess starts.

Well-maintained units? I’ve seen them run past 200,000 miles (321,000 km). Neglected ones? They start acting weird around 120,000 miles (193,000 km), and by 150,000 (241,000 km) they’re a ticking time bomb.

Which Transmissions It Uses

FN4A-EL

  • 4-speed automatic
  • FWD
  • 2.3L MZR I4
  • 2003–2005
  • Hydraulic unit with electronic control

This is the early four-speed. It’s not garbage. But it’s the most wear-sensitive of the bunch.

FS5A-EL

  • 5-speed automatic
  • FWD
  • 2.3L MZR I4
  • 2006–2008
  • Updated ratios and revised control strategy

This one’s better. Smoother. Less frantic on the highway. Still fluid-sensitive.

JA5A-EL

  • 5-speed automatic
  • FWD
  • 3.0L Duratec V6
  • 2003–2005

The V6 box. More torque load. Same story — maintenance decides its fate.

G35M-R

  • 5-speed manual
  • FWD
  • 2.3L MZR I4
  • 2003–2008

Strong gearbox. Clutches wear. Gears don’t typically lunch themselves.

A65M-R

  • 5-speed manual
  • FWD
  • 3.0L V6
  • 2003–2008

Handles torque fine. You’ll replace clutches before you ever open the case.

Mazdaspeed6 6-Speed Manual (AWD)

  • 6-speed manual
  • AWD
  • 2.3L DISI Turbo
  • 2006–2007
  • Separate transfer case and rear differential

This is the wild child. Extra hardware. Extra cost. Extra risk if you ignore it.

No CVT. No dual-clutch. No secret alternates. What you see above is what you get.

Main Failure Patterns

Automatic Fluid Neglect

I’ll say it bluntly: these automatics hate dirty fluid.

Mazda specified ATF M-V. Shops that dumped universal fluid in because “it’ll be fine” created shift complaints that show up years later. I’ve seen it dozens of times.

  • Harsh 2–3 shift
  • Delayed Drive engagement
  • Torque converter clutch shudder at 45 mph (72 km/h)

By 70,000–110,000 miles (113,000–177,000 km), degraded fluid starts cooking the clutch packs. Temperatures creep above 200°F (93°C). Friction material sheds. You drop the pan and see glitter on the magnet. That’s not decoration. That’s wear.

FN4A-EL Valve Body Wear

This four-speed gets sloppy with age.

Pressure regulator bore wear. Solenoid performance degradation. Line pressure gets inconsistent. Shifts flare. Customers think the tranny is done.

Sometimes it is. Sometimes it just needs a valve body.

Above 120,000 miles (193,000 km), this becomes common. Catch it early and you’re looking at a repair. Ignore it and the clutches burn. Then it’s rebuild time.

TCC Shudder

You’re cruising at 40–55 mph (64–88 km/h). Light throttle. The car vibrates like you drove over rumble strips.

That’s the torque converter clutch slipping and grabbing. Dirty fluid is the usual suspect. Once the lining starts shedding, it contaminates the whole unit. A simple drain-and-fill can fix early shudder. Wait too long and you’re pricing converters.

Manual Transmission Reality

The G35M-R and A65M-R gearboxes are solid. I don’t see gear failures unless someone’s abusing them or running the fluid dry.

What I do see:

  • Clutch discs worn out at 100,000–140,000 miles (160,000–225,000 km)
  • Hydraulic release bearing leaks

Normal wear. Not drama.

Mazdaspeed6 Transfer Case and Rear Differential

This is where things get expensive.

The AWD system uses a separate transfer case and rear diff with GL-5 gear oil. Ignore that fluid and you’ll hear the warning: a rising whine under load, then a howl on decel.

Drain the oil and you’ll find metallic shavings. Sometimes chunks. I’ve opened a few that looked like they’d been sandblasted inside.

Most failures show up between 90,000–130,000 miles (145,000–209,000 km) when no one ever serviced the gear oil.

Typical Repair Costs

Let’s talk money. Because this is where owners get blindsided.

Repair Type Parts (USD) Labor (USD) Total (USD) Basis
Valve body replacement (FN4A-EL) $500–$950 $700–$1,100 $1,200–$2,000 Industry Estimate
Full automatic rebuild $2,000–$3,000 $1,500–$2,200 $3,500–$5,200 Service Bay Benchmark
Reman automatic installation $3,000–$4,200 $1,200–$1,900 $4,200–$6,100 Industry Estimate
Manual clutch replacement $450–$750 $1,000–$1,600 $1,450–$2,350 Service Bay Benchmark
Mazdaspeed6 transfer case replacement $1,500–$2,500 $900–$1,500 $2,400–$4,000 Industry Estimate

A rebuild on a high-mileage early car can exceed the car’s value. I’ve had customers stare at a $4,800 estimate like I just insulted their family.

Best and Worst Years

Model Years Configuration Transmission Projected Risk Primary Concern
2003–2005 2.3L I4 FWD FN4A-EL Medium Valve body wear
2006–2008 2.3L I4 FWD FS5A-EL Low–Medium Fluid sensitivity
2003–2005 3.0L V6 FWD JA5A-EL Medium TCC shudder
2006–2007 2.3L Turbo AWD 6-speed manual + transfer case Medium–High Transfer case wear

The early four-speed cars carry the most long-term wear exposure. The later FS5A-EL cars are smoother and tend to age better if serviced.

Warning Signs & Early Detection

  • RPM flare between gears
  • Shudder at steady cruise
  • Delayed engagement into Drive
  • Burnt ATF smell
  • AWD whine under throttle

If I’m inspecting one pre-purchase, I scan it. I road test it. I check fluid color. I look for metallic paste on the pan magnet. On a Mazdaspeed6, I always check the transfer case fluid. Always.

Skipping that inspection is how you inherit someone else’s $4,000 mistake.

When to Walk Away

Black fluid. Hard slipping. No service records past 120,000 miles (193,000 km).

Transfer case howling like a siren.

Those aren’t small issues. They’re expensive ones.

A band-aid fix might buy time. It won’t save the gearbox.

Ownership Reality

Category OEM Guidance Real-World Outcome Cost Impact
Automatic fluid interval No aggressive interval specified Fluid degrades by 60k–80k miles (97k–129k km) Valve body wear and clutch damage
AWD gear oil service Periodic inspection Often ignored $2,000+ driveline exposure
“Lifetime” perception No dipstick on later automatics Owners delay service Higher rebuild probability

Manufacturers talk about long service intervals. In the real world, fluid breaks down. Heat kills it. Stop-and-go traffic cooks it. I tell owners 40,000–50,000 miles (64,000–80,000 km) for drain-and-fill. It’s cheap insurance.

Lawsuits, Complaints & Regulatory History

No class-action storm around these transmissions. No massive recall campaigns targeting internal defects.

NHTSA complaints exist — mostly shift quality, slipping, age-related wear. The pattern looks like normal mechanical aging, not systemic failure.

Still, I always tell buyers: run the VIN through the official NHTSA lookup. Takes five minutes. Removes doubt.

Bottom Line

This generation of Mazda 6 isn’t cursed. It isn’t flawless either.

The FN4A-EL four-speed demands respect. The FS5A-EL is better but still fluid-sensitive. Manuals are durable. The Mazdaspeed6 AWD setup adds complexity and cost.

Maintain it and it’ll treat you well. Ignore it and it’ll empty your wallet.
